Abstract

Benign cementoblastoma is a rare odontogenic tumour derived from odontogenic ectomesenchyme of cementoblast origin that forms cementum layer on the roots of a tooth. Benign cementoblastomas have a distinct clinical and radiographic appearance. It is important to consider them as one among the differential diagnosis in bony swellings of mandible. A case report of a 55 yr old female patient diagnosed as a case of benign cementoblastoma is presented.
